The company, which recently finalized a deal to spin off its U.S. business, blames technical problems.
Throngs of TikTok users say the social media platform suppressed or delayed videos about the fatal shooting of a Minneapolis man by federal immigration agents, charging that posts tied to the incident drew few views or were stalled amid broader techn… [4068 chars]
